Market Segmentation
The WiFi and Bluetooth Modules for IoT Market Analysis by types is segmented into:
WiFi and Bluetooth modules for IoT are widely available in the market in different package types. The LCC package is a popular choice for its compact size and low cost. The LCC + LGA package offers additional features such as better signal quality and easier integration. Other market types may include variations of packaging such as BGA or QFN. These options cater to different preferences and requirements of IoT developers looking to incorporate wireless connectivity into their devices.
